2009-05-21 30 views

回答

14

難道你不知道它;我張貼這只是後,我發現Scott Hanselman's Blog一種變通方法,在註釋:

1)右鍵單擊設計文件,然後選擇刪除

2)右鍵單擊ASPX文件,並選擇轉換爲Web應用

感謝馬修,無論你在哪裏。

17

更簡單:

我的實驗包括簡單地打開designer.cs文件,在該文件中的某個地方輸入一個字符,刪除新的字符,保存文件並重新編譯。

找到That One Developer Blog,它對我來說非常合適。

+1

對於任何人到達這裏尋找與VS的更高版本和WPF相同的錯誤,我發現相同的問題,只有在遵循此過程後纔會修復,但不保存文件。 – 2013-11-13 14:40:40

1

打開desiner.cs文件 輸入一些文字 刪除您輸入的文字。 保存並構建應用程序。

0

關閉解決方案並刪除Temporary ASP.Net文件目錄爲我解決了這個問題。 [link]

2

這一個已經爲我工作: - 「打開desiner.cs文件在其中鍵入一些文字刪除您鍵入的文本保存和構建應用程序」

非常感謝Jitendra庫馬爾!

3

我現在面臨同樣的錯誤。我不得不在編輯aspx文件時打開設計器文件,一旦完成,保存兩者。您甚至不必在設計器中輸入任何文字。這就是訣竅!

0

我得到這個錯誤,當我雙擊錯誤的asp.net按鈕,並刪除它在aspx文件和.cs文件中的後綴,但不是在Designer.cs文件中。確保所有三個文件都得到了更新。

4

我面臨同樣的問題。我通過從項目中排除此文件並重建解決方案來解決此問題。然後再次包含此文件...完成!

好運!

1

***我知道這是一個老問題了,已經回答了,但我'將我的回答,希望這會幫助別人

在我的案例中提到的文件是的.cs類,並且因爲有沒有.desiner.cs文件,我需要另一種解決方案

所以我的情況的解決方案是瀏覽解決方案文件夾在Windows資源管理器中,並刪除。suo文件,重新打開解決方案並重新編譯